I-2, impahla yensimbi eqinile yophawu lwesango i-valve ibhola le-valve kanye nendlela yokuqinisa isihlalo
Njengamanje, inqubo evamile yokuqina ebusweni be-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ve ye-valve yensimbi eqinile ingokuyinhloko ngale ndlela elandelayo:
(1) I-ball surface spray welding (noma i-spray welding) ithuluzi le-carbide enosimende, ubulukhuni bungafinyelela cishe ku-40HRC, inqubo yethuluzi le-carbide ye-ball surface ye-spray iyinkimbinkimbi, ukukhiqizwa nokusebenza kahle kokukhiqiza akuphezulu, kanye nesilinganiso esikhulu. I-spray welding kulula ukwenza izingxenye ze-deformation, manje uhlelo lokusebenza lwenqubo yokuqinisa ibhola luncane.
(2) I-oxidation eqinile yebhola, ubulukhuni bungafinyelela ku-60 ~ 65HRC, ukujiya okungu-0.07 ~ 0.10mm, ungqimba lwensimbi engagqwali ubulukhuni obuphezulu, ukumelana nokugqoka, ukumelana nokugqwala futhi kungagcina ubuso bukhanya, inqubo elula, izindleko eziphansi. Kodwa-ke, ubulukhuni bokunamathela kwe-chromium eqinile buzoncishiswa ngokushesha ngokukhululwa kokucindezeleka okushisayo lapho izinga lokushisa likhuphuka, futhi izinga lokushisa layo lokusebenza alikwazi ukuba ngaphezu kuka-427℃. Ngaphezu kwalokho, inhlanganisela ye-stainless steel layer iphansi, futhi ukugqoka kulula ukuwa phansi.
(3) Ingaphezulu lebhola liyi-plasma nitriding, ubulukhuni bobuso bungafinyelela ku-60 ~ 65HRC, ukushuba kongqimba lwe-nitriding yokwelashwa kungu-0.20 ~ 0.40mm, izinga lokushisa eliphansi le-plasma nitriding yokwelashwa kwe-substrate inqubo eqinile ngenxa yokumelana kwayo nokugqwala okubuthakathaka, ayikwazi isetshenziswe esitshalweni samakhemikhali etching eqinile nakwezinye izimboni.
(4) Inqubo ye-ball surface supersonic spraying (HVOF), ubulukhuni buphezulu kakhulu, ingafinyelela ku-70 ~ 75HRC, amandla aphezulu, ukujiya okungu-0.3 ~ 0.4mm, ukufutha nge-supersonic kuyinqubo eyinhloko yokuqina kwebhola. Uketshezi olubonakalayo oluphezulu ezitshalweni zamandla ashisayo, isofthiwe yesistimu yemishini ye-petrochemical, imboni yamandla namakhemikhali; Le nqubo yokuqina isetshenziswa oketshezini oluningi oluyinhlanganisela, imidiya yoketshezi egqwala kakhulu enomsizi nezinhlayiya eziqinile.
Inqubo yokufafaza nge-supersonic iyinqubo lapho ukushiswa kukaphethiloli we-oxygen kubangela ukuthi igesi yokucindezela okukhulu isheshise umthelela wezinhlayiya zempushana endaweni yokusebenza yomkhiqizo futhi ikhiqize ukumbozwa okuphezulu okuphezulu. Kusixhumanisi sokushayisana, ngoba ijubane lezinhlayiyana liyashesha (500-750m / s) futhi izinga lokushisa lezinhlayiyana liphansi (-3000 ℃), ukugqoka okunamandla okubopha okuphezulu, i-porosity ephansi kanye nokuqukethwe okuhlobene kwe-metal oxide kungatholakala ngemuva ukungqubuzana endaweni yokusebenza. Isici se-HVOF ukuthi ijubane lezinhlayiyana ze-alloy powder lidlula isivinini somsindo, ngisho nezikhathi ezi-2 ~ 3 zejubane lomsindo, futhi isivinini esimaphakathi sesiphepho izikhathi ezi-4 zejubane lomsindo.
I-HVOF iwubuchwepheshe obusha bokukhiqiza nokucubungula, ukujiya kwepende ku-0.3 ~ 0.4mm, phakathi kwe-coating kanye ne-workpiece mechanical bonding, amandla okubopha okuphezulu (77MPa), i-porosity yokunamathela iphansi ( I-spray welding yinqubo yokufafaza nge-arc ebusweni bezinto ezihlanganisiwe zensimbi. Kunge-pyreogen powder (impushana yensimbi, i-alloy powder, i-ceramic powder ingaba) ukufudumeza ukuncibilika noma ukwenza i-plasticity ephezulu, nesishingishane sigeleza kuso, sinqwabelana phezu komkhiqizo ngemuva kokwelashwa kwangaphambili, kwakha ungqimba kanye nesiqeshana somkhiqizo. ubuso (ipuleti) ungqimba oluqinile lwe-fusion (welding).
Futha i-welding kanye ne-spray welding hardbase process alloy kanye ne-substrate inenqubo yokuncibilika, ithuluzi lokusika i-carbide kanye ne-substrate inendawo encibilikayo eshisayo, ukuze kuzuzwe ngokuphelele ukushiswa kwe-spray noma izici ze-welding carbide cutting layer, vimbela ngemva kokwelashwa ukushisela indawo encibilikayo eshisayo yokuxhumana kwensimbi. indawo, i-spray welding ehlongozwayo noma i-spray welding carbide cutting tool ukujiya kumele ibe ngaphezu kuka-3mm ngaphezulu.
3. Ukuqina kwendawo yokuxhumana ye-valve ye-valve ye-valve ye-valve yesango eliqinile kanye nesihlalo se-valve kuyahambisana
Indawo yokuxhumana eshelelayo yezinto zensimbi idinga ukuba nobulukhuni obuthile, ngaphandle kwalokho kulula ukukhiqiza isimo sokufa. Ezinhlelweni ezithile, umehluko wokuqina phakathi kwebhola le-valve evamile kanye nesihlalo se-valve ngu-5 ~ 10HRC, futhi i-valve yokuhlukanisa ubulukhuni ingaba nempilo enhle yesevisi. Ngenxa yokuthi ukukhiqizwa kwebhola nokucubungula okuyinkimbinkimbi, izindleko zokukhiqiza eziphezulu, ukuze kuvikelwe ibhola akulula ukulimala nokulimala, ngokuvamile ukukhetha ubulukhuni bebhola buphakeme kunobulukhuni bendawo yokuhlala.
Ukuhlanganiswa kokuqina kokuqina kwesihlalo se-valve kungcono ukuze lezi zinhlobo ezimbili zokuqina zibambisane: (1) Ubulukhuni bebhola le-valve 55HRC, indawo yesihlalo se-valve engu-45HRC, ingaphezulu lebhola le-valve lingasebenzisa isifutho se-supersonic i-Stellite20 i-aluminium alloy, indawo yesihlalo se-valve. ingathatha isifutho sokushisela i-Stellite12 aluminium ingxubevange, ubulukhuni bokusebenzisana yi-valve yensimbi yophawu lwensimbi esetshenziswa kabanzi ubulukhuni bokuxhumanisa, ingahlangabezana nezidingo eziyisisekelo zomonakalo wensimbi yensimbi eqinile ye-valve ye-valve yebhola; Ukuqina kobuso bebhola le-valve kungu-68HRC, ingaphezulu lesihlalo se-valve ngu-58HRC, ingaphezulu lebhola le-valve lingaba yi-subsonic spraying tungsten carbide, indawo yesihlalo se-valve ingaba yi-supersonic spraying Stellite20 aluminium alloy, ubulukhuni busetshenziswa ngamandla futhi imboni yamakhemikhali, enokumelana nokugqoka okuphezulu kanye nempilo yesevisi.
Phesheya kwezilwandle, ibhola le-valve nendawo yesihlalo se-valve kuhambisana ngobulukhuni obufanayo. Wonke amabhola e-valve nendawo yesihlalo se-valve asebenzisa inqubo ye-subsonic yokufafaza i-tungsten carbide, futhi ukuqina kwendawo kungaphezu kuka-72HRC. Ngisho nangaphansi kwesisekelo sokuqina okuphezulu kakhulu, ibhola le-valve nesihlalo se-valve sithinta phezulu futhi akulula ukusibulala. Kodwa okwamanje ibhola lethu le-valve lenza ubulukhuni bobuso obungaphezulu kwebhola le-valve engu-72HRC, isihlalo se-valve asibona ubuchwepheshe bokugaya obuphelele, kunzima ukuqinisekisa ukuthi ibhola le-valve nokubambisana kwesihlalo se-valve, ukusetshenziswa kuncane.
I-4, i-hard seal esangweni i-valve ibhola le-valve ibhola kanye nokuqina kwesihlalo naka inkinga
Izinto ezingasetshenzisiwe zebhola le-valve yensimbi eqinile yesango kanye nesihlalo se-valve ngokuvamile kukhethwa ipuleti lensimbi engagqwali noma izinto zokusetshenziswa ezimelana nokugqwala, ngaphandle kwalokho ithuluzi le-carbide nesihlalo se-valve (noma ibhola) kulula ukugqwala ngezinto, okuholela ekuweni kongqimba lwamathuluzi e-carbide. phansi, kulimaze impilo yesevisi ye-valve yebhola.
Ngaphezu kwalokho, ngokusho kwesihlalo se-valve esihlukile (noma ibhola le-valve) izinto zokusetshenziswa kufanele zikhethe inqubo yazo yokuqina, emkhakheni wamandla kanye nemboni yamakhemikhali isetshenziswa ezintweni zokusetshenziswa zensimbi ezinezigaba ezimbili, izinto zokusetshenziswa zensimbi ezinezigaba ezimbili zinokumelana nokugqwala okungcono. ukukhathala nokugqoka izici zokugqwala.
Izinto zokusetshenziswa zensimbi ezinezigaba ezimbili ziwuhlobo lwensimbi olunakho kokubili ukwakheka kwe-metallographic kanye nesakhiwo se-austenitic, i-microstructure kanye nesakhiwo se-austenitic esingaba ngu-50%, futhi indlela yezigaba ezimbili ikhona, izici zayo zokusebenza zombili ziyinsimbi ephansi ye-alloy kanye nensimbi engagqwali engama-430. izici. Ezicini ezingama-430 zensimbi engagqwali, lapho izinga lokushisa liyi-400 ~ 500 ℃ ububanzi, ukwahlukanisa okushisayo okuhlala isikhathi eside kuzoveza ukuguga okuthile, lesi simo ngokuvamile sibizwa ngokuthi ukuguga okungu-475℃; Lapho izinga lokushisa lidlula 400 ~ 500 ℃, izici zensimbi yezigaba ezimbili zingabhujiswa.
Uma i-spray welding noma inqubo yokusika ithuluzi lokusika i-spray isetshenziselwa izinto zokusetshenziswa zensimbi ye-biphase, inqubo yokuncibilika kwethuluzi lokusika i-carbide ne-substrate (izinga lokushisa elizungezile ngokuvamile lingaphezu kuka-900 ℃), lizolimaza ukwakheka kwe-alloy yezinto zokusetshenziswa zensimbi ye-biphase. , ngakho-ke izinto zokusetshenziswa zensimbi ze-biphase akufanele zisebenzise i-spray welding (noma i-spray welding) inqubo yokuqinisa ithuluzi lokusika i-carbide. Inqubo yokufafaza ye-supersonic ilungele inqubo yokuqina kwe-biphase yensimbi yezinto zokusetshenziswa. Inqubo yokuqina kufanele iqinisekise ukuthi ukwakheka kwe-alloy ye-biphase steel raw materials akukwazi ukonakala.
